Crown Burger: A Utah Staple

Crown Burger: A Utah Staple

We start our list off with in my opinion, the best burger in the state.  No list of Utah restaurants would be complete without Crown Burger.  Their signature item, The Crown Burger is a delicious Thick Cut Pastrami Cheeseburger with lettuce, onion, and fry sauce.  Accompany that with fries and a Chocolate Shake and you have a gut buster fit for a king.  If burgers aren’t your thing, they have delicious sandwiches, corn dogs, gyros, and salads.  With 7 locations across the Wasatch Front, you are sure to find something you love.

Moochies

If you are in the mood for a great Philly sandwich, look no further than Moochies.  Having been featured on Diners, Drive-Ins, and Dives, their Philly is not complete without a healthy dose of jalapeno sauce.  While I do not waste my time on anything BUT the Philly when I come in, I also hear that the Meatball Sub is out of this world.  Lines for these famous sandwiches are usually out the door.  Portions are huge, so be prepared to take some home with you.  After several years in their downtown location, Moochies recently ventured and opened a second location in Midvale and a third in Lehi.  If you are in the mood for a uniquely Utah sandwich, this must be your first stop.

Olympus Burger

Olympus Burger has been around for quite a while offering a unique combination of American staples and Greek items.  Family owned and operated, they take great pride in serving some of the best food in the state. The one reason why I included them on this list however was for their Gyro sandwich.  One of the things I remember growing up was when I was in High School, coming to get their Gyro Combo with amazing fries and 4 containers of Fry Sauce (seriously if you don’t know what Fry Sauce is, here is a recipe, go and try it for yourself.  It will change your world)  Homemade tzatziki sauce, piles of gyro meat and warm pita bread are a welcome change to the classic burgers and worth stopping by for.  With two locations in the Salt Lake Valley, you should have no problem getting in and trying for yourself.

R&R BBQ

R&R BBQ the best barbecue joint in the state, if not the country.  (You are welcome to try and change my mind) R&R offers true BBQ to Utah with their smoked meats and unique menu.  Everything on their menu is smoked, tender, and generous with their portion sizes.  If you were going to have one thing however, have the Brisket Tacos.  If you want the full experience, get the 3 meat plate with Brisket, Sausage, and Shredded Chicken.  Their sauces round add a kick of flavor that rivals any I have had in my travels through the country.  For Dessert, have the delicious homemade Bread Pudding.

R&R has taken the state by storm with 7 locations across Salt Lake, Davis, and Utah counties including in Vivint Smart Home Arena, home of the Utah Jazz.  Anytime you are in a 3 mile radius of the place, you can smell the delicious smoked meats calling you in.  If you are in the mood for a BBQ experience like no other, check out R&R BBQ.

Burger Bar | Roy, UT

Burger Bar | Roy, UT

Driving through the small, unassuming town of Roy, Utah on the outskirts of Ogden and Hill Air Force Base, one could miss a classic Utah staple known simply as “Burger Bar”

Burger Bar in Roy Utah

They serve a classic Hamburger, made many different ways and also include some of the more exotic.  Elk, Buffalo, and an exotic meat of the month.  Some of the exotic meats have included Camel, Rabbit, Shark, and Yak.  In addition to Hamburgers, they serve Corn Dogs, Fish Sandwiches, Chicken Sandwiches, Veggie Burgers, Onion Rings, Fries, and Deep Fried Mushrooms to name a few.

There is no drive through or sit down area, instead you have to park your car and come up to the window to order.  There are two main menu signs to choose from and there is always a line to order.  Everything is made fresh.

In the Summertime, the parking lot is a hopping tailgate party with people bringing their lawn chairs and making it a picnic.

Best Burger in the State

My personal favorite is their classic Quad Cheese Ben, which is a standard Cheeseburger with 4 patties.  You can also add Bacon if you would like for an extra charge.  Pair that nicely with some Onion Rings and a Lime Rickey (Sprite with Grape syrup and limes) and you have yourself the best Hamburger experience in the State of Utah.

My wife always is a fan of the classic Corn Dog and Fries with a shake.  (Yes, they have amazing above the rim shakes as well.)
